The tricolor of the Russian Federation was painted on European Square in Odesa

(Photo: National Police in Odesa region)

In Odesa, unknown persons painted a Russian flag on the pedestal left after the demolition of the monument to Catherine II on European Square.

According to the press service of the National Police in Odesa region, law enforcement officers are already establishing the circumstances of the incident.

In the morning, on May 16, the police received a report from a passerby that one of the fragments of the pedestal in the middle of the square was painted with colors similar to the flag of the aggressor country, and one of the memorial photos was contaminated.

"Officers of the territorial police unit are currently working at the scene. Measures are being taken to identify the person involved in the incident. It will be legally classified after all the circumstances are clarified," the statement said.
